Troubleshooting Earpiece Issues: Your Guide to Preventing It

Experiencing discomfort from your hearing aid insert? You're not alone! Many individuals face this issue, but it's often preventable. At Dr. Goldberg ENT, we understand the difficulty that comes with hearing aid discomfort. That's why we've put together some helpful tips to minimize irritation.

  • Make sure your hearing aids fit properly. A good seal is essential to prevent pressure. If you're unsure about the fit, consult with your audiologist.
  • Wash your hearing aid domes daily. Dirt and ear debris can contribute to irritation. Use a soft cloth and a mild soap solution.
  • Alternate your domes regularly to prevent wear and tear on a single area.
  • Select soft, hypoallergenic domes made of memory foam. These materials are better suited to minimize irritation.
  • If you continue to experience pain, don't hesitate to contact your audiologist. We can offer recommendations to improve your comfort.
